1.1 BACKGROUND OF THE STUDY
From the era of industrial revolution inventory has been known to be one of the most important assets to many companies representing a good percentage of total invested capital, managers have long recognized that good inventory control is crucial. A firm can try to reduce cost by reducing on hand inventory levels. (Abara 2011) on the other hand, argues that customers become dissatisfied when frequent inventory outages called stock-out occur. Thus, companies must make the balance between low and high inventory levels. As you would expect, cost minimization is the major factor in obtaining this dislocate balance.
Raw materials, work –in – progress and finished goods are examples of inventory. Inventory generally refers to the materials in stock. It is also called the idle resources of an organization according to( Stevenson 2009); an inventory is a stock of goods, ( Nahinias 2001) defines inventory as a stock of physical goods held at a specific location at a specific time.
Inventory in the researchers understanding may refers to goods or materials that an organization hold for the purpose of production and sales. Inventory levels of finished goods are direct function of demand oncewe determine the demand for completed clothes for example, it is possible to use this information to determine how much cotton, sewing machines, sewing thread and other raw materials and work-in-progress are needed to produce the finished product.(Abara 2011). Inventory control is among the most important operation management function because inventory requires a huge amount of capital and this affect the delivery of goods to customers, inventory control has an impact on several business function especially in operations, marketing $ finance is concern with the overall financial structures of a firm including funds allocation to inventory. Operations need inventories to ensure smooth and efficient production.
Inventory of different kinds are found in organization like INNOSON company, but there vary a lot in number and nature of the material held. Inventories in such manufacturing firm take many forms such as raw material or components, intermediate work-in-progress, finished goods and distribution inventories centers is and attempt to balance inventory needs and requirement with the need to minimize cost resulting from obtaining and holding inventory ( Helm 2006); refers to inventory control as the supervision of supply, storage and accessibility of items in order to ensure adequate supply and minimize over supply. ( Sinichi Levi et al 2003). The main motive of keeping inventories differ between companies depending on if the inventory is design for a process flow of material
The organizational performance in the content of these work could imply measure of output over input within an organization, which could be in terms of cost reduction, quality enhance and revenue generation. My interest is to know more about inventory control in organizational performance
